On 31 Jan 2006, at 05:53 PST, <dzhou21 at tntech.edu> wrote:
> I downloaded the source code tar.gz file for BIND 9.3.2 and then ./
> configure, make, make install, create zone files, and named.conf
> file. and then run /usr/local/sbin/named as root. When i PS, named
> is running, but i failed to find any log file, and the name lookup
> from other machines failed.
Which distribution are you using: OpenSuSE or SuSE Linux? My SuSE
Linux 9.3 system came with BIND 9 and had routines in /etc/sysconfig
used by YaST to configure name services. The default location for
named is in /var/share/named.
